A lively, handwritten script with a consistent rightward slant and smooth, rounded terminals. Strokes feel pen-driven and mostly even, with modest thick–thin modulation and frequent entry/exit swashes that create a flowing rhythm. Letterforms are compact and tall, with long ascenders/descenders and occasional extended cross-strokes and curls, giving words a gently connected, continuous texture. Capitals introduce more ornamental loops and open counters, while lowercase maintains a steady, readable cadence.
Well suited to short-to-medium display settings where personality matters: invitations, wedding collateral, greeting cards, boutique packaging, and lifestyle branding. It can also work for pull quotes or headers when set with generous size and breathing room to preserve the delicate joins and flourishes.
The overall tone is polished yet personable—suggesting classic correspondence, boutique branding, and lighthearted sophistication. Its soft curves and looping joins add warmth and charm, while the italic motion and careful proportions keep it feeling intentional rather than casual.
The design appears aimed at delivering a refined, calligraphic handwriting look that remains legible in phrases and titles. Flourished capitals and smooth connections suggest an emphasis on charm and elegance for decorative typography rather than dense body text.
Spacing appears slightly tight in running text, reinforcing a cohesive, ribbon-like word shape. Numerals are simple and rounded with handwritten irregularity, matching the script’s tempo and avoiding overly geometric forms.
